The wire’s strength should not be underestimated either. Despite its thinness, the 22 gauge offers substantial tensile strength, ensuring stability and enduring performance. This strength is crucial in applications involving suspension or where load-bearing capacity is a concern. Professional users in industries such as construction often prefer this variant for tasks that require a strong, yet manageable wire, such as tying rebar or creating wire meshes to provide added structural support. Beyond its physical attributes, 22 gauge galvanized wire stands out for its economic efficiency. The cost-effectiveness of this wire is particularly beneficial for projects requiring extensive quantities without compromising on quality or performance, thus offering exceptional value for money. This affordability makes it an attractive option for both large-scale industrial applications and smaller, budget-conscious DIY projects. When considering the environmental aspect, galvanized wire also offers sustainability benefits. Zinc, the primary element in the galvanization process, is a material that can be recycled and reused without degradation. As a result, opting for 22 gauge galvanized wire can contribute to more sustainable building practices and reduced environmental impact, aligning with modern ecological standards.
